Working Minors
Rules regulating the employment of minors are contained in WAC Chapter 296-125.
The minimum age for employment in the state of Washington is fourteen, WAC 296-125-018.
The number of hours a minor may work is outlined in WAC 269-125-027.
WAC
269-125-027 (3) "Sixteen- and seventeen-year-old minors who have been issued
a certificate of educational competence pursuant to RCW
28A.305.190 (GED), are enrolled in a bona fide college program (Running
Start), are named on a valid certificate of marriage, or are shown as the parent
on a valid certificate of birth may work as would be permitted during school
vacations."
